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Azure Cup | California alder |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(Fungi)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Ascomycota (Sac Fungi)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Pezizomycetes (Pezizomycetes)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Pezizales (Pezizales) | Fagales (Beeches & Oaks) |
| Family | Pezizaceae | Betulaceae |
| Genus | Peziza | Alnus |
| Species | Peziza azureoides | Alnus rhombifolia |
